Faster Diagnosis Scheme for Urgent Suspected Cancer Referrals

This is a National scheme that is run to help people who are displaying symptoms, or who have had a test result, that could suggest the presence of cancer and need to be seen by a specialist as quickly as possible. There are many common conditions that these symptoms could be linked to, and most people who have an urgent referral do not have cancer.

A fast tracked referral will help to quickly exclude or diagnose any serious conditions and help you access the right treatment options as soon as possible.

NHS e-Referral Tracking

If your doctor has referred you to a specialist for further care you will be asked to book your appointment using the ‘NHS e-Referral’ system.

You will receive a letter from us within 2 weeks giving details of how to book your appointment and any passwords you may need.

To track your e-Referral you will need the following details to log into the e-Referral website:

  • Your date of birth
  • Reference number – this will be on the first page of your letter
  • Password – this will be on the second page of your letter

Patient Advice & Liaison Services

 

PALS is a free and confidential service that provides help when it is needed. 

Members of the PALS team act independently when handling patient and family concerns, liaising with staff, managers and, where appropriate, relevant organisations to negotiate immediate or prompt solutions.

PALS can help and support you with:

  • advice and information
  • comments and suggestions
  • compliments and thanks
  • informal complaints
  • advice about formal complaints
  • chasing up referrals and appointments

 If the PALS team cannot answer your questions, they will put you in contact with someone who can help you.
